Caring for Baby Birds: A Beginner's Handbook

Successfully caring for baby turkeys requires diligent attention to detail, especially during their early period. Young poults are incredibly sensitive and demand a protected space, typically around 90-95°F (32-35°C) to start. Offering a pen with clean bedding is crucial, and one must important to maintain it clean to protect against infection. Frequent availability to clean water and high-quality poultry feed is also necessary for healthy development.

Female Turkey Behavior: Nesting & Motherhood

Once the springtime arrives, hens will start the task of nesting. They meticulously select a area, often secluded amongst plants or beneath shrubs. The nest itself is a basic depression dug in the soil and padded with leaves . Following egg deposition , the hen will incubate them for approximately four weeks, abandoning the nest only briefly to feed for sustenance. Motherhood for a turkey hen is a challenging job; she fiercely protects her chicks from threats and shows them to nourishment sources, demonstrating them essential survival techniques until they grow into adolescents ready to sustain themselves.
